Rusted Rhino’s debut premieres at Cinequest; follow-up “Half Life of Mason Lake” in post

“DIMENSION,” the debut feature from Rusted Rhino Production Company, had its world premiere at The Cinequest Film Festival in San Jose, Calif., where it was one of 14 narrative features in the Maverick Competition, out of 1,872 submissions.

“Dimension” was also one of only two narrative features in competition at the recent Big Muddy Film Festival in Carbondale.

Matthew Scott Harris wrote, produced and directed the film, about the residents of a Chicago neighborhood who are given the opportunity “to alter three inches of their lives.”

Once this enigmatic gift is presented, the film explores the characters’ myriad interpretations. Starring producer Mary Kay Cook, Paul Turner, Deanna Dunagan, Harlan Hogan, Marco Kyris, and Cedric Young.

Rusted Rhino is in post-production on their second feature “The Half Life of Mason Lake,” the story of a woman coping with her husband’s critical brain injury. “Half Life” shot last spring. Writer/director Tim Lotesto is producing with Harris and Christopher W. Marty.
